Delta APC Congress: Strength, Strategy, and Signals That Matter (EDITORIAL)
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on LinkedinShare on Whatsapp

When party faithful of the All Progressives Congress (APC) gathered at the Cenotaph in Asaba for the Delta State Congress, the election of Chief Solomon Arenyeka as State Chairman should have been the story. Instead, attention immediately turned to who was absent. Senators Ovie Omo-Agege and Ned Nwoko were not at the venue, prompting some to speculate about fractures within the party.

Such speculation is unfounded. It collapses under the weight of facts.

Only weeks before the congresses, Senator Omo-Agege, a former Deputy Senate President and APC governorship candidate in 2023 in Delta State attended a stakeholders’ meeting at Government House, Asaba. There, he publicly acknowledged Governor Sheriff Oborevwori as the state party leader and pledged to work with him for the party’s success, urging inclusive governance as the pathway forward. That was not lip service. It was a deliberate, unequivocal signal of alignment.

Hon. Stella Erhuvwuoghene Okotete, Executive Director (Business Development) at the Nigerian Export-Import Bank (NEXIM), was also absent, but her engagement in another state as an official of a congress reflects responsibility, not withdrawal.

Meanwhile, key Omo-Agege allies were present in Asaba. Chief Ayiri Emami, Rt. Hon. Friday Osanebi, Hon. Efe Ofobruku, and former Secretary to the Delta State Government, Chief Ovuozourie Macaulay, attended and actively participated. These are influential actors whose presence signals cohesion, not alienation.

Political parties are living, dynamic entities. Internal debate, tension, and negotiation are inevitable. But tension is not dysfunction. True cracks appear in parallel structures, boycotts, and open defiance. None of that happened at the Asaba congress.

The Delta APC demonstrated organisational continuity. A new executive was elected. Processes concluded without disruption. Stakeholders across political camps engaged and coordinated. Any narrative suggesting otherwise is manufactured, relying on optics rather than substance.

ALSO READ  Why Efe Ofobruku Is Emerging as a Strong Option for Uvwie/Okpe/Sapele in 2027

The facts are clear: Delta APC is recalibrating under new leadership, with major figures publicly committed to collaboration. Unity in politics is proven not by attendance at a single event but by sustained action, strategic alignment, and shared objectives.

Those who rush to declare division would do well to stop chasing shadows. Delta APC is focused, purposeful, and poised to advance its agenda. The congress was not a moment of fragility, it was a demonstration of resilience, discipline, and forward-looking strategy.
